Growth-dissolution kinetics data for garnet liquid phase epitaxy on (111) substrates are first order and are well represented by Van Erk's function (W. van Erk, J. Crystal Growth 43 (1978) 466) when liquidus temperatures are properly determined by accounting for the nonlinearity of growth-dissolution rate with temperature. © 1979.
